Do I need to be at home to control my smart home?
No. If you have set up and enabled Control Anywhere in the IKEA Home smart app, you can connect with DIRIGERA hub and your smart products even outside of your Wi-Fi.
Control Anywhere needs to be set up, similar to other integrations, while you are connected to your home's Wi-Fi. This also applies for turning it on or off. If Control Anywhere is turned on or off, the setting applies for all users that have access to the same DIRIGERA hub.

Why is there a delay when controlling devices through Control Anywhere?
You might experience a few seconds delay when controlling your devices remotely. If your system is acting really slow, try to restart of the DIRIGERA hub when you are back home.

Why should I buy a DIRIGERA hub when I already have a TRÅDFRI gateway?
IKEA will fully focus on the development of DIRIGERA and will not release any new products or features to the IKEA Home smart 1 app and TRÅDFRI gateway after April 2024.
